数据看板是现代工作中不可或缺的工具,它能够帮助团队实时监控关键业务指标,做出快速决策。在数据看板中,按钮的设计和功能往往被忽视,但它们却是信息传递的关键枢纽。本文将揭秘如何让按钮在数据看板中发挥高效的信息传递作用。
按钮设计原则
1. 简洁直观
按钮设计应遵循简洁直观的原则,确保用户一眼就能理解其功能。避免使用复杂的图标或文字,使用户在短时间内能够识别按钮的作用。
2. 逻辑清晰
按钮的布局和分组应遵循一定的逻辑,使用户在使用过程中能够轻松找到所需功能。例如,将相似功能的按钮放在一起,或将常用按钮放在显眼位置。
3. 交互反馈
按钮应提供即时的交互反馈,让用户知道操作已成功执行。例如,按钮点击后可以变色、出现动画效果或显示提示信息。
按钮功能设计
1. 数据筛选
数据看板中的按钮可以用于筛选数据,帮助用户快速定位所需信息。例如,通过按钮选择特定时间段、部门或项目,展示相关数据。
2. 数据导出
按钮可以用于将数据导出为常用格式,如Excel、CSV等,方便用户进一步分析或分享。
3. 数据对比
通过按钮实现不同数据源或不同时间段的数据对比,帮助用户发现数据之间的联系和差异。
4. 数据预警
当数据达到预设阈值时,按钮可以自动触发预警,提醒用户关注关键业务指标。
代码示例
以下是一个简单的Python代码示例,用于实现数据筛选功能:
import pandas as pd
# 创建一个示例数据集
data = {
'日期': ['2021-01-01', '2021-01-02', '2021-01-03'],
'部门': ['A', 'B', 'A'],
'销售额': [100, 200, 150]
}
df = pd.DataFrame(data)
# 定义筛选函数
def filter_data(df, department=None, date_range=None):
if department:
df = df[df['部门'] == department]
if date_range:
df = df[(df['日期'] >= date_range[0]) & (df['日期'] <= date_range[1])]
return df
# 调用筛选函数
filtered_data = filter_data(df, department='A', date_range=['2021-01-01', '2021-01-03'])
print(filtered_data)
总结
在数据看板中,按钮是高效信息传递的关键枢纽。通过遵循设计原则、实现丰富功能,并借助代码示例进行辅助,可以让按钮在数据看板中发挥更大的作用。在实际应用中,不断优化按钮设计和功能,将有助于提升数据看板的使用效果。
